Gear steel is a generic term for the steel that can be used to process and manufacture gears. Generally there are low carbon steel such as 20# steel, low carbon alloy steel such as: 20Cr, 20CrMnTi, etc., medium carbon steel: 35# steel, 45# steel, etc., medium carbon alloy steel: 40Cr, 42CrMo, 35CrMo, etc., can be called gear steel.

This type of steel usually has good strength, hardness, and toughness after heat treatment according to the requirements of use, or the surface is wear-resistant and the heart has good toughness and impact resistance.
